In collaboration with the University of Copenhagen
We are seeking two postdoctoral researchers to join ScreenPoint Medicals Innovation team in Copenhagen in a joint project with the University of Copenhagen. You will be employed by ScreenPoint Medical Danish office and work in a team on cutting-edge foundation models for breast cancer recurrence while being mentored by a professor in Computer Science and AI at the University of Copenhagen.
This unique position bridges industry and academia: you will have access to ScreenPoints large-scale clinical breast imaging data and product expertise while benefiting from an academic research environment publication freedom and world-class scientific supervision.
You will be part of a highly motivated and interdisciplinary team of experts in breast imaging artificial intelligence and clinical research working in close collaboration with the Innovation team in Nijmegen and Copenhagen.
Your responsibilities
- Design and develop robust foundation and world models (e.g. vision transformers vision-language models LeJepa) tailored to breast imaging data.
- Apply and adapt foundation models to downstream tasks focused on breast cancer detection and risk in women with earlier diagnosed cancers.
- Collaborate closely with ScreenPoints AI Algorithm Lead and AI Research Engineers to ensure robust integration between foundation models MLOps infrastructure and downstream evaluation metrics.
- Perform and report on in-depth model analysis including calibration subgroup performance and failure-mode assessment.
- Publish findings in high-impact peer-reviewed journals and present at leading international conferences supported by your academic supervisor at the University of Copenhagen.
Experience and skills
- PhD in Computer Science Machine Learning Biomedical Engineering Applied Mathematics Physics Statistics or a closely related technical field.
- Proven research experience with foundation models and state-of-the-art deep learning methods (vision transformers vision-language models self-supervised learning).
- Publication track record.
- Experience in medical imaging or clinical AI research is strongly preferred.
- Ability to translate clinical or scientific questions into appropriate modeling approaches (e.g. classification risk prediction longitudinal modeling).
- Strong understanding of model evaluation calibration robustness and subgroup performance in real-world datasets.
- Proficiency in Python and deep learning frameworks (e.g. PyTorch) and experience working in Linux-based environments and GPU clusters.
- Excellent written and spoken English and the ability to work both independently and collaboratively.
Preferred qualifications
- Experience with breast data (e.g. xray MRI).
- Familiarity with NLP LLMs or vision-language models (VLMs).
- Experience with self-supervised or weakly supervised learning on large-scale datasets
- Prior publications in top-tier AI or medical imaging venues (NeurIPS ICCV MICCAI CVPR etc.).
